Abstract The cis-trans ratio of the alkenes formed in Wittig reactions of semistabilised ylides (derived from benzyltriarylphosphonium salts in ethanolic sodium ethoxide) with benz-aldehyde, acetaldehyde or trimethylacetaldehyde increases as steric crowding at phos-phorus increases. In contrast, the cis-trans ratio of the unsaturated esters formed in the related reactions of the stabilised ethoxycarbonylmethylene ylides decreases as steric crowding at phosphorus increases. The relevance of these results to recent proposals for the mechanism of the Wittig reaction is considered.
